Set in the heart of the Lake District National Park, this stone-built home blends period character with practical, modern living. Two reception rooms feature exposed beams and cast-iron fireplaces; a cosy living area centres on a wood-burning stove, while the adjoining dining room and breakfast kitchen provide flexible family space. The ground floor also offers a useful utility/playroom, cloakroom and direct access to a low-maintenance paved garden and rear parking.
Upstairs there are four double bedrooms, each retaining original cast-iron fireplaces; the master benefits from an en-suite and there is a separate family bathroom. The property is presented as a comfortable, average-sized home (approx. 1,160 sq ft) ideal for families or anyone seeking a peaceful main residence or second home within a desirable village setting. Off-street parking for two cars and a powered garden store add practical convenience.
Important practical points: the house dates from before 1900 and the stone walls are assumed uninsulated, which may affect energy efficiency and running costs. The double glazing installation date is unknown. The plot is small and low-maintenance, and broadband speeds are average for the area. No flood risk is recorded; crime is very low and mobile signal is excellent.
Offered freehold and with no onward chain, this property presents a rare chance to secure a character home in a National Park village, but buyers should factor potential improvement works (insulation, energy upgrades) into their plans.
